  • Viruses can be engineered to deliver nucleic acids, peptides and proteins for plant trait reprogramming. Building on market approvals and sales of recombinant virus-based biopharmaceuticals for veterinary and human medicine, similar innovations may be applied to agriculture for transient or heritable biodesign of crops with improved performance and sustainable production.

  • Gene duplication and subsequent paralogue diversification shape phenotypes. This study shows how paralogues controlling stem cell proliferation evolve over short time scales and provides an evo-devo perspective for trait engineering in crop design.
